Hello,
 
I was looking to buy more expensive headphones (€150+) but I decided that maybe I should try something a bit cheaper first and I narrowed it down to the above 3 headphones as they seem to be good bargains at their current prices.
 
I will be mostly listening to EDM from my PC or iPad / mobile (no amp)
 
Isolation and portability are not needed. Comfort is important, but not much, because I rarely listen for more than 1 hour at a time.
 
Approximate current prices:
 
Logitech UE6000: €80
 
Yamaha HPH-200: €70
 
Creative Aurvana Live!: €60
 
How do the above compare between them, and how much worst are they from higher priced headphones such as the Fidelio X1 or the ATH-M50x?

Haven't heard the Yamaha but I love UE6000 and CAL! And I'd pick them in a heartbeat over the M50x. The X1 is another story. UE6000 has better bass and mids than CAL! but the CAL has the better treble while still having quite good bass and mids just not as good as the UE
